§ 48-17-108 — Waiver or approval by fiduciaries
Tennessee·Title 48
Each fiduciary, including such acting as executor, administrator, guardian, committee, agent, or trustee, who is a shareholder of record, whether the corporation issuing such shares is foreign or domestic, may waive notice or lapse of time pursuant to § 48-17-106 and may consent to the taking of any corporate action pursuant to § 48-17-104 .
